Jamiat Ulama may make some big announcement before general elections

New Delhi: Jamiat Ulama, the oldest Muslim organisation of the country, may make some big announcement before the general elections.

According to reliable sources, a general body meeting will be held on March 14 at the head office of Jamiat Ulama under the chairmanship of Maulana Syed Arshad Madani.

Proposals would be presented on several key issues during the meeting. Though Jamiat Ulama Hind is a non-political party however the organisation keeps track of the politics of the country.

Matters like 2019 elections, Babri Masjid title suit, arbitration on the matter, imprisonment of innocent Muslim youth and its solution and Assam NRC are likely to be discussed during the meeting.
